在此公开了发送设备、接收设备和传输系统。该发送设备包括:纠错码计算部分,用于根据作为信息字的传输对象的数据来计算纠错码;划分部分,用于将构成通过将由纠错码计算部分的计算而确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线;以及多个传输部分,与多条传输线对应地提供,并且用于通过传输线将由划分部分分配的编码数据发送到接收设备。(*该技术在2021年保护过期,可自由使用*)
【技术实现步骤摘要】
本公开涉及一种发送设备、接收设备和传输系统。
技术介绍
随着信息量的增加,要求提高信号处理LSI (大规模集成电路)之间的接口的传输速度。为了满足该要求,采用诸如多路并行信号处理、提高接口的时钟频率、降低信号的电压等技术。然而,对于上面刚刚描述的技术,噪声耐受性降低,导致难以正确地发送数据。此外,在与要求抑制功耗相关的接口,诸如移动设备的信号处理LSI之间的接口中,不要求这样提高传输速度,而促进电压的降低,且难以正确地发送数据。为了解决上面描述的这些问题,已经进行了传输信道的电性能的改善,诸如⑶R(时钟数据恢复)电路或者均衡器的性能的改善,并且还采用由接收端校正由噪声造成的错误的纠错码。作为纠错码,可以采用里德-所罗门(Reed-Solomon)码等。在接收端的LSI中,可以执行纠错码的解码处理以在某种程度上校正数据错误。Serial ATA:High Speed Serialized AT Attachment Revision I. Oa (2003 年 I月7日)列为现有技术的非专利文献。
技术实现思路
在普通的LSI之间的接口中,即使在LSI之间采用多条传输线,通常仍利用同一单个传输路径发送具有附加到其的纠错码的由传输数据构成的一个码字的数据。因此,如果一个码字中出现的位错误的数目超过校正能力(该校正能力取决于纠错码的位数),则该错误不能校正,导致数据丢失。取决于系统,检测校正中的故障并执行数据重发。信号处理LSI之间的接口要求的传输能力在加速提高,并且这使得很可能发生传输错误,并且难以保证足够重发数据的传输频带因此,希望提供可以在提高数据的传输速度的同时增强纠错能力的发送设备、接收设备和传输系统。根据所公开技术的第一实施例,提供了发送设备,包括纠错码计算部件,适配为根据作为信息字的传输对象的数据来计算纠错码;划分部件,适配为将构成通过将由纠错码计算部件的计算而确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线;以及多个传输部件,与多条传输线对应地提供,并且适配为通过传输线将由划分部件分配的编码数据发送到接收设备。发送设备可以配置为使得划分部件将具有预定值的填充数据分配到向其分配比其它传输线更少量的编码数据的任意传输线,使得分配等于向其它传输线的编码数据的分配量的编码数据量,并且与向其分配了填充数据的传输线对应地提供的发送部件紧接着编码数据发送填充数据。在该情况下,划分部件以从纠错码计算部件提供编码数据的顺序,向传输线中的不同传输线分配构成同一码字的编码数据。根据所公开技术的第二实施例,提供了接收设备,包括多个接收部件,与多条传输线对应地提供,并适配为接收从根据作为信息字的传输对象的数据计算纠错码的发送设备发送的编码数据,将构成通过将由计算确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线,以及发送分配到该传输线的编码数据;耦合部件,适配为基于由多个接收部件接收到的编码数据产生码字;以及纠错部件,适配为基于由耦合部件产生的码字中包括的纠错码来执行传输对象的数据的纠错。接收设备可以配置为使得在传输设备将具有预定值的填充数据分配到向其分配比其它传输线更少量的编码数据的任意传输线,以使得分配等于向其它传输线的分配量的编码数据量,并且该填充数据由与向其分配了填充数据的传输线对应的接收部件之一接收的情况下,耦合部件去除填充数据。根据所公开技术的第三实施例,提供了包括发送设备和接收设备的传输系统。该传输设备包括纠错码计算部件,适配为根据作为信息字的传输对象的数据来计算纠错码;划分部件,适配为将构成通过将由纠错码计算部件的计算而确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线;以及多个传输部件,与多条传输线对应地提供,并且适配为通过传输线将由划分部件分配的编码数据发送到接收设备。该接收设备包括多个接收部件,与传输线对应地提供,并且适配为接收从发送设备发送的编码数据;耦合部件,适配为基于由多个接收部件接收到的编码数据产生码字;以及纠错部件,适配为基于由耦合部件产生的码字中包括的纠错码来执行传输对象的数据的纠错。在所公开技术的第一实施例中,纠错码计算部件根据作为信息字的传输对象的数据计算纠错码。划分部件将构成通过将由纠错码计算部件的计算而确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线。然后,与多条传输线对应地提供的多个传输部件通过传输线将由划分部件分配的编码数据发送到接收设备。在所公开技术的第二实施例中,与多条传输线对应地提供的多个接收部件接收从根据作为信息字的传输对象的数据来计算纠错码的传输设备发送的编码数据,将构成通过将由计算确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线,以及发送分配到传输线的编码数据。然后,耦合部件基于由多个接收部件接收到的编码数据产生码字。然后,纠错部件基于由耦合部件产生的码字中包括的纠错码来执行传输对象的数据的纠错。在所公开技术的第三实施例中,发送设备根据作为信息字的传输对象的数据来计算纠错码;将构成通过将由计算确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线。此外,发送设备利用与多条传输线对应地提供的多个传输部件通过传输线将所分配的编码数据发送到接收设备。同时,接收设备利用与传输线对应地提供的多个接收部件接收从发送设备发送的编码数据。然后,接收设备基于由多个接收部件接收到的编码数据产生码字;并基于所产生的码字中包括的纠错码来执行传输对象的数据的纠错。总之,利用发送设备、接收设备和传输系统,在提高数据的传输速度的同时,可以增强纠错能力。附图说明图I是示出传输系统的配置的示例的框图;图2是示出传输数据的重排的示例的简图;图3是示出纠错编码的示例的简图;图4是示出传输数据的传输线划分的示例的简图; 图5是示出传输数据的传输线划分的另一个示例的简图;图6是示出传输帧的帧构成的简图;图7是示出传输数据的传输线耦合的简图;图8是示出纠错解码的示例的简图;图9是示出发送端模块的发送处理的流程图;图10是示出接收端模块的接收处理的流程图;图11是示出传输系统的修改例的框图;以及图12是示出计算机的配置的示例的框图。具体实施方式模块的配置图I示出根据在此公开的技术的实施例的传输系统的配置的示例。参考图1,所示的传输系统I包括发送端模块11和接收端模块12。发送端模块11和接收端模块12例如由互相不同的LSI实现,或者由相同的LSI实现并提供在其中处理信息的同一设备中,该设备诸如是数码相机、便携式电话机或者个人计算机。在图I所示的示例中,发送端模块11和接收端模块12通过四条传输线Cl至C4互相连接。传输线Cl至C4可以是有线传输线或者无线传输线。此外,发送端模块11与接收端模块12之间的传输线的数量可以是5个或者更多。发送端模块的配置首先,描述发送端模块11的配置。发送端模块11包括信号处理部分21、重排处理部分22、ECC (纠错码)处理部分23、划分部分24和发送处理部分25_1至25-4。发送处理部分25-1包括帧形成部分31-1、调制部分3本文档来自技高网...
【技术保护点】
一种发送设备,包括:纠错码计算部件,适配为根据作为信息字的传输对象的数据来计算纠错码;划分部件,适配为将构成码字的编码数据以每预定数量为单位分配到多条传输线,其中通过将由所述纠错码计算部件的计算而确定的纠错码附加到传输对象的数据而获得所述码字;以及多个传输部件,与多条传输线对应地提供,并且适配为通过传输线将由所述划分部分分配的编码数据发送到接收设备。
【技术特征摘要】
2010.11.19 JP 2010-2585701.一种发送设备,包括纠错码计算部件,适配为根据作为信息字的传输对象的数据来计算纠错码;划分部件,适配为将构成码字的编码数据以每预定数量为单位分配到多条传输线,其中通过将由所述纠错码计算部件的计算而确定的纠错码附加到传输对象的数据而获得所述码字;以及多个传输部件,与多条传输线对应地提供,并且适配为通过传输线将由所述划分部分分配的编码数据发送到接收设备。2.根据权利要求I所述的发送设备,其特征在于所述划分部件将具有预定值的填充数据分配到向其分配比向其它传输线分配更少量的编码数据的任意传输线,以使得分配等于向其它传输线分配的编码数据的分配量的编码数据量;以及与向其分配了填充数据的传输线对应地提供的传输部件紧接着编码数据发送填充数据。3.根据权利要求2所述的发送设备,其特征在于,所述划分部件以从所述纠错码计算部件提供编码数据的顺序,向传输线中的不同传输线分配构成同一码字的编码数据。4.一种接收设备,包括多个接收部件,与多条传输线对应地提供,并且适配为接收从根据作为信息字的传输对象的数据来计算纠错码的发送设备发送的编码数据,将构成通过将由计算确定的纠错码附加到传输对象的数据而获得的码字的编码数据以每预定数量为单位分配到多条传输线,以及发...
【专利技术属性】
技术研发人员:新桥龙男,舟本一久,松本英之,城下宽司,丸子健一,杉冈达也,越坂直弘,
申请(专利权)人:索尼公司,
类型:实用新型
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。